Feet On Sand


Q:
Age: 58   Sex: M   Concern: Nerves on Feet  

A few months back, I developed a tingling sensation from knees to feet; feels like I am standing on sand on a beach 24/7; loosing my gait and controls of my legs and walking. The neurologist could not determine a root cause. Any suggestions

Separately, I had an MRI of full spine and subsequently had an ACDF of C5/6 and C6/7. With physio, I have improved on gait. However the feet are still in Sand.

-- jjg


A:
The gait instability is probably due to your cervical disc problem. The sand feeling could be from your neck as well. However I think an MRI for the lumbar spine is reasonable to rule out stenosis.

-- Sherman Nam Tran, M. D.
